Independent Living Skills

The Independent Living Skills Program (ILS) provides former foster youth the tools and resources they need to transition smoothly into becoming independent and self-sufficient adults.

The program helps ensure that, upon exiting foster care, youth will be enrolled in college, vocational programs and/or be employed, as well as be in a stable housing situation.

Last year, we helped 241 foster youth to develop independent living skills.

Aftercare Services

Upon leaving the foster care system, aftercare services are available until a youth’s 21st birthday.

Such services may include: financial assistance for employment or educational purposes, housing assistance, scholarships, Medi-Cal, household items, gift cards and other resources, when possible.
